Sort by
45 Products
View
Sort by
-
KarenMillen£99.00
-
KarenMillen£85.00 £68.00 ( -20 % off )
-
KarenMillen£75.00 £60.00 ( -20 % off )
-
KarenMillen£99.00
-
KarenMillen£99.00
-
KarenMillen£85.00 £68.00 ( -20 % off )
-
KarenMillen£85.00 £68.00 ( -20 % off )
-
KarenMillen£129.00
-
KarenMillen£119.00 £95.20 ( -20 % off )
-
KarenMillen£69.00 £55.20 ( -20 % off )
Shirts for Women